Какой параметр display нужно установить, чтобы получить эту колонку?

Здравствуйте! Я пытался настроить свойства display (flex, grid), но в результате колонки не выстраиваются так, как показано на втором фото. Не могли бы вы подсказать, какие свойства мне использовать для правильного отображения?
  • 13 февраля 2025 г. 16:34
Ответы на вопрос 2
Чтобы выстроить колонки так, как вы хотите, можно использовать как CSS Grid, так и Flexbox. Вот основные подходы для каждого метода:

### Flexbox

Если вы используете Flexbox, то настройте контейнер следующим образом:

```css
.container {
    display: flex; /* Включаем flex-контейнер */
    flex-direction: row; /* Указываем направление главной оси (по умолчанию) */
    justify-content: space-between; /* Распределяет пространство между элементами */
    align-items: stretch; /* Выравнивание по высоте (по умолчанию) */
}
.column {
    flex: 1; /* Каждая колонка будет занимать равное пространство */
    margin: 10px; /* Отступ между колонками, при необходимости */
}
```

### CSS Grid

Если вы выбираете Grid, его настройка может выглядеть так:

```css
.container {
    display: grid; /* Включаем grid-контейнер */
    grid-template-columns: repeat(3, 1fr); /* Создаем 3 колонки одинаковой ширины */
    gap: 10px; /* Расстояние между колонками и рядами */
}
```

В обоих случаях, возможно, вам нужно будет отрегулировать `margin`, `padding`, а также размеры колонок в зависимости от вашего макета.

Если вы можете указать, какой именно эффект или расположение колонок вы пытаетесь достичь, я смогу дать более точные рекомендации!
У вас должно быть 5 div-ов с родительским div  у которого display: flex.
Похожие вопросы